我希望我的node.js程序每30秒打印一次foo。所以我写了这样的代码:
let count = 0
function foo () {
console.log(`foo`)
count += 1
// do other things that takes about 20 seconds.
}
while (count < 10) {
console.log(`inside while loop`) // my screen keep printing `inside while loop` until "JavaScript heap out of m
在启动剩下的代码之前,我有一些js脚本加载到我的main.js中。然而,在测试过程中,我注意到,有时它会产生以下引用错误(每8个页面中就有1个)。
ReferenceError: createContainer is not defined
现在,我能想到得到这个错误的唯一原因是,当我执行startScript()函数时,并不是所有的文件都被加载或完全可访问。
现在,也许我把其他.js文件包含到我的main.js中是错误的,所以我想听听您对此的想法。
main.js看起来如下:
$(document).ready(function() {
//sets and array of f
我是JS的初学者,现在正在编写一个javascript应用程序 在应用程序中有一个按钮,当用户点击它时,门应该打开10秒,然后再次关闭 我使用"set interval“通过以下方式来实现此功能: var rVars = []
rVars.push( {name:"door", val:1} ) // 1 for open , 0 for close
_server.setRoomVariables(r, user, rVars)
var params = {}
params.user = user
params.r = r
我正在尝试使用Netlify函数访问FaunaDB来启动我的新web应用程序,虽然它似乎在本地工作得很好(通过netlify dev),但当它在线时,感觉每第三次调用数据库都会失败,并出现以下错误: FetchError: request to https://db.fauna.com/ failed, reason: write EPIPE
at ClientRequest.<anonymous> (/var/task/src/node_modules/faunadb/node_modules/node-fetch/lib/index.js:1461:11)
at Client
我想在网站上显示一个每2秒自动更新的图表。 我还不是很了解JavaScript。我找到并尝试了这个示例:https://blog.heimetli.ch/chart-js-update.html var getData = $.getJSON('/value');
getData.done(function (result) {
var zeit = result.zeit;
var flow = result.flow;
var ctx = document.getElementById("myChart");
var myChart =
我在我的网站上使用google Maps API。我显示了一条路线,路线的距离和持续时间。因此,我有以下代码: <script>
function initMap() {
var map = new google.maps.Map(document.getElementById('map'), {
zoom: 5,});
var directionsService = new google.maps.DirectionsService;
var directionsDisplay = new google.maps.DirectionsRenderer(
因此,我有一个从onload事件调用的函数:
var called = 0;
function getAll()
{
var msg = "hello everyone";
alert("hi");
setTimeout(startTimerRepeat, 5000, msg);
}
function startTimerRepeat(content)
{
document.getElementById('howmanyLbl').innerText = "Called " + called +
如果我克隆引导程序:git clone https://github.com/twbs/bootstrap
然后做个怪罪:git blame js/src/alert.js
看起来每一行都是同一个人最后一次接触到的:
^7ffb61a (Patrick H. Lauke 2017-04-17 00:04:49 +0100 1) import Util from './util'
^7ffb61a (Patrick H. Lauke 2017-04-17 00:04:49 +0100 2)
^7ffb61a (Patrick H. Lauke 2017-04-17 00: